Dysart looking into installing LED streetlights

Dysart could be getting an upgrade to their street lights. Director of Public Works, Brian Nicholson submitted a request to council yesterday to look into installing LED lights for each stop light in the municipality.

Nicholson says energy costs with the current lights run over $48,000 a year and the upgrade could reduce costs by 70 per cent. He also said maintenance costs for the current lights cost close to $11,000. Installing LED lights will reduce those costs with a 20 year lifespan.

Council approved moving forward to receive more information from Local Authority Services.
